Mission and Goals

The Objectives of the Coalition are:

To create a full partnership among sexually transmitted disease (STD) project areas directly funded by the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ention, state and local public health agencies, the Federal Government and private agencies to effectively prevent and control STDs in the US and its territories;

  • To provide a conduit of communication and technology transfer among
    and between STD Directors nationally;

  • To provide a forum for technical assistance and dissemination of information about effective STD prevention and control programs among members
    of the Coalition;

  • To educate federal, state and local policy makers about issues relevant
    to the control, prevention and elimination of STDs;

  • To network or affiliate with appropriate organizations working toward comparable goals; and

  • To promote adequate and efficient allocation of resources to the prevention and control of STDs.
